Snacking when I WFH used to be constant. Since I WFH 3-5 times a week this was a habit I HAD to break. Sipping water or coffee all day (except 30 minutes after eating), plus planning my mealtimes /snacks every 2 hours during the day works best for me.  I have breakfast at 8, snack at 10, lunch at 12, snack at 2, then I am done work at 3.  I don't always adhere completely to this schedule on non-workdays, but it definitely got rid of my mindless snacking when I was working.
